Fall athletes to be honored

Peabody-Burns High School athletic department will have a fall sports banquet at 7 p.m. Thursday in the Brown Gymnasium.

Student athletes to be honored will be participants in cheerleading, cross-country, football, and volleyball.

This year the banquet will be a dessert banquet.

“Due to lack of funds, we will be trying something different,” Athletic Director Ray Savage said. “We ask that each family bring a dessert — cookies, cake, brownies, pie, cheesecake, any type of dessert — at approximately 6:45 p.m.

“The desserts will be placed on a common table, available to all from 7 to 7:15 p.m.”

Savage said the athletic department will supply drinks, napkins, utensils, plates, cups, and ice cream.

Coaches’ comments and presentations will follow the banquet.

“As always, we ask that everyone remember this is a banquet and dress accordingly,” Savage added.

After the banquet, parents of students interested in going out for basketball will have a meeting to discuss insurance, physicals, medical releases, and allow coaches to discuss their programs. The meeting will begin at approximately 8 p.m. and last about half an hour.
